A brief discussion of etiology and diagnosis of chronic ankle instability precedes results of a follow-up study of a modified Evans procedure. Between 1974 and 1980, 29 patients with chronic ankle instability were operated on at Harrison Community Hospital. Of the patients who replied to the follow-up study, 75% reported good functional stability. Assessment of surgical results was 62.5% excellent, 25% good, 6.25% satisfactory, and 6.25% poor.
